Soto Mata Seoi Otoshi

Soto-mata-seoi-otoshi - Outer Thigh Shoulder Drop

Soto-mata-seoi-otoshi is simply a seoi-otoshi (or, in this case a ryo-hiza-seoi-otoshi) where the technique has not worked quite to plan and so the arm that was under the uke's arm grabs hold of the outer thigh of uke to aid in the throw. Although this is possible with other versions of Seoi-otoshi, but is not as likely as the ryo-hiza-seoi-otoshi - particularly as this may become a hiza-soto-muso.
